What positioning accuracy can GNSS antennas achieve?

Our anti-jamming positioning antennas support RTK differential positioning with horizontal accuracy of 0.8cm+1ppm and vertical accuracy of 1.5cm+1ppm, meeting high-precision application requirements such as mine safety monitoring.

Can the antennas work in extreme environments?

Yes. Our antennas operate in temperatures ranging from -40°C to +70°C, storage from -55°C to +85°C, with 95% non-condensing humidity. They pass strict industrial-grade reliability tests for mining, desert, polar and other extreme environments.

Which satellite systems are supported?

Full support for BDS, GPS, GLONASS, and Galileo satellite systems, covering B1I/B1C/B2a/B2b/B3I, L1/L2/L5, G1/G2, E1/E2/E5a/E5b/E6 frequency bands with 1408 tracking channels.
